Domestic to Hong Kong, land transportation is available. Here are some common methods of land transportation:
1. Container Transportation: Shipping goods from domestic locations to Hong Kong via container transport is a common land transportation method. It's suitable for bulk or fragile shipments, but it's important to note that all customs procedures and documents must be arranged in advance.
2. Consolidated Shipping: Consolidated shipping involves grouping multiple shipments together for transport as a full truckload. This method is suitable for small-lot cargo and offers flexibility and convenience.
3. Bulk Shipping: Bulk shipping is suitable for general cargo or goods that do not require protection, transported in bulk form. While this method is relatively cost-effective, it is important to note the packaging and protection of the goods.
4. Courier Service: If the goods are small and need to reach Hong Kong quickly, courier service can be chosen. There are many domestic courier companies offering services to Hong Kong. You can select an appropriate courier company based on the size, weight, and urgency of the goods.
Whichever method you choose, it's essential to prepare for goods packaging, protection, and transportation in advance. Additionally, familiarize yourself with Hong Kong's customs regulations and procedures to ensure smooth overland transport.

The scope of road transport from mainland China to Hong Kong mainly includes the following aspects:
1. Travelers: Domestic travelers have the option to travel to Hong Kong by car. Generally, travelers arriving in Hong Kong can enter through cross-border buses, long-distance coaches, or by driving themselves.
2. Containerized Cargo Transportation: Domestic companies can opt to ship their goods to Hong Kong via land transportation. Generally, cargo can be transported into Hong Kong using trucks, vans, and other land-based transportation vehicles.
3. Express Delivery: Domestic courier companies can choose to transport express packages to Hong Kong by road. Packages can be sent from mainland China to their destination in Hong Kong via the distribution network of logistics companies.
Be mindful that as a special administrative region of China, Hong Kong has specific regulations and procedures for cross-border transportation. Before opting for road transportation, it's advisable to consult with relevant logistics companies or local transportation authorities to understand the specific transportation regulations and requirements.
